A Regina lawyer is facing a charge of obstructing justice.
According to the Regina Police Service, Sharon R. Fox was charged after an investigation into what police called “an allegation of an improper disclosure of information, affecting an ongoing police investigation.”
Police allege the incident occurred in Regina on Oct. 21, 2019. They note the case which allegedly was affected hasn’t made it completely through the court system, so no other details about the case were made available.
In a media release, police said Fox, 37, was charged for attempting “to obstruct, pervert or defeat the course of justice.” She’s to appear in Regina Provincial Court on Sept. 22.
